Transaction 6899535ff351b45d553901853d9830e7499ae4150cf131a6f8795719a63e2715

1 Input
2 Outputs
  • 6899535ff351b45d553901853d9830e7499ae4150cf131a6f8795719a63e2715:0
  • value  2038226516
    address  178wpxRNS2REUkvY6cDkmmhJ4GqZ49CbLz
  • 6899535ff351b45d553901853d9830e7499ae4150cf131a6f8795719a63e2715:1
  • value  1200000
    address  1Fho9AJFRUq8UPApsziKjgHrPCy3dNmWXU